What is the climate like in Adelaide?

Adelaide enjoys a hot‑summer Mediterranean climate, with hot, dry summers and cool, moderately rainy winters, and about 90 clear days each year.

What major cultural events does Adelaide host?

The city is renowned for its vibrant arts calendar, including the Adelaide Festival, the Adelaide Fringe, WOMADelaide, and the Adelaide 500, which together draw visitors from around the world.

How is the layout of Adelaide’s city centre designed?

Adelaide was planned by Colonel William Light using a grid layout known as “Light’s Vision,” featuring wide boulevards, a central square, and a surrounding ring of public parklands.
